The "Rail-Wheel Contact Simulator" at Center for Railway Research (CRR), IIT Kharagpur can be used for following:
(1) Test "Friction Modifiers (FM's)" to be applied on railway wheels/railway track to reduce wear, contact noise, and energy consumption
(2) Recreate conditions at railway wheel-track contact (pressure, shear stress, sliding speed, environment, etc.) in laboratory. This can be used to troubleshoot problems related to wheel-rail wear and rolling contact fatigue
(3) Determine traction-slip characteristics under different operating conditions (pressure, sliding speeds, environment, etc.) that help determine braking distance, conditions for wheel locking, and maximum traction that can be obtained
The "Rail-Wheel Contact Simulator" has six hydraulic actuators that can used under closed loop motion or load control. Very precise location control (to less than 50 microns) is being achieved on the machine. Normal load, lateral load, roll angle, roll centre, yaw angle, yaw centre, can be independently varied. Peak contact pressures of up to 1500 MPa can be achieved.
The "Reconfigurable Mechanical Loading Setup" can be used to do uni-/bi-axial testing of large suspension elements such as air-springs, conical rubber springs, coil springs, etc. in monotonic or cyclic loading conditions. Vertical, lateral, torsional and bending rigidities of springs/structures/joints can be tested on these machines.
